Woody Leonhard has covered Windows Dummies foibles and fantasies since the days of Windows XP. With more than a million regular readers, he's Senior Contributing Editor at InfoWorld, and Senior Editor at Windows Secrets, where he weighs in daily on all things Windows. A self-described "Windows victim," Woody specializes in telling the truth about Windows in a way that won't put you to sleep.
